Pavement sealing is a process that invol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and walkways. This coating helps to create a barrier against water, oil, and other substances that can cause damage over time. The service typically includes cleaning the surface thoroughly to remove dirt, debris, and oil stains before applying the sealant. Proper sealing not only enhances the appearance of the pavement but also extends its lifespan by preventing cracks, potholes, and surface deterioration caused by weather exposure and regular wear and tear.

One of the main problems pavement sealing addresses is the prevention of water infiltration. Water that seeps into cracks can freeze and expand during cold weather, leading to larger cracks and structural damage. Seal coating fills small cracks and creates a smooth, impermeable surface that helps keep moisture out. Additionally, sealing helps protect against oil, gasoline, and other chemicals that can stain or weaken asphalt surfaces. Property owners who notice fading, surface cracking, or oil stains on their pavement may find sealing to be an effective way to restore and preserve their investment.

The overview below groups typical Pavement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Madison,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or pavement sealing projects, such as patching small cracks or spots,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size of the area and surface condition.

Standard Sealcoating - For sealing larger driveways or parking areas,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. This is a common price band for most residential and small commercial jobs in Madison, AL.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ger projects, including extensive parking lots or multiple surfaces, can reach $1,500 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, usually when surface preparation or surface repairs are also needed.

Full Surface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of pavement can cost $5,000+ depending on size and scope. These are less common and typically reserved for severely damaged surfaces requiring extensive work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
